Good Energy Group has signed an agreement with DONG Energy which will see the Chippenham-based renewable electricity supplier and generator source offshore wind power for its customers for the first time.

UK-based ecology consultancy Thomson Ecology has been contracted by DONG Energy to undertake the Phase 2 ecological surveys to inform the 2.4GW Hornsea Project Three offshore wind farm onshore cable route Environmental Statement.
Deepwater Wind, the developer of the first offshore wind farm in the US, reported on 16 March that its Block Island Wind Farm had shown strong performance during the winter storm Stella, which hit the northeast of the US earlier this week.
Scottish Minister for Business, Innovation and Energy Paul Wheelhouse granted planning consent to the two-turbine Dounreay Trì Floating Wind Demonstration Project on 17 March.
Avangrid Renewables, LLC, a subsidiary of Iberdrola, has secured a lease sale of 122,405 acres offshore Kitty Hawk, North Carolina, for offshore wind development after 17 auction rounds with a winning bid of USD 9,066,650. Fred. Olsen Windcarrier has shared a photo of its wind turbine installation vessel Brave Tern hard at work transporting and installing wind turbine components at Iberdrola’s 350MW Wikinger offshore wind farm in the German part of the Baltic Sea.

The jacket foundation for the Race Bank 01 offshore substation (OSS), installed after the Race Bank 02 OSS, was placed and fixed to the seabed at the offshore wind farm site on 15 March, with the 2,900t topside up next.
The US Bureau of Ocean Energy Management (BOEM) will today auction off 122,405 acres offshore North Carolina for commercial wind energy leasing. 42 out of 50 MHI Vestas V112-3.3MW turbines have been installed at the 165MW Nobelwind offshore wind farm in the Belgian North Sea, Parkwind, the developer and part owner of the wind farm, reports.
DONG Energy has started dismantling the world’s first offshore wind farm, the 4.95MW Vindeby located in the Danish Baltic Sea near the island of Lolland.
